WebMar 22, 2024 · Introduction. Durable Functions is an extension of Azure Functions. It enables us to write stateful functions in a serverless environment, and it allows us to define workflows in code. The extension lets us define stateful workflows in a new type of function called an orchestrator function. WebNov 11, 2024 · Like Logic Apps you can schedule Functions to perform recurring tasks and flows (durable function). One of the triggers for Azure Functions is the timer-trigger – allowing you to run a function on a schedule. With the timer trigger, you can use cron-expression to define when the function needs to run.
